如何在ASP.NET中用程序代码设定DATAGRID每列的宽度以及折不折行

来源:互联网 发布:网络分销怎么做 编辑:程序博客网 时间:2024/05/16 15:15
评论(0)发表时间:2006年12月14日 9时28分 [%=@count%]票 [[%=@percent%]%]
提交
感谢您使用微软产品。

ASP.NET中,每一列的宽度是由ItemStyle所控制的。如ItemStyle-Width,ItemStyle-Wrap等。
                
<asp:BoundColumn HeaderText="Author ID" DataField="au_id" ItemStyle-Width="200" ItemStyle-Wrap="false"/>

 
如果您需要用编程的方法控制的话,您可以用DataGrid1.Columns(1).ItemStyle.Width来设置属性。请参考以下的代码:

VB.NET:

DataGrid1.Columns(1).ItemStyle.Width = new Unit(200)
DataGrid1.Columns(1).ItemStyle.Wrap = false

注:ASP.NET会将相应代码转化为HTML代码。其最终形为是由浏览器所决定。

具体ItemStyle属性,请点击以下链接:

http://msdn.microsoft.com/library/default.asp?url=/library/en-us/cpref/html/frlrfSystemWebUIWebControlsDataGridColumnClassItemStyleTopic.asp

 

希望对您有所帮助。

 

-微软全球技术中心 VB技术支持
 
原创粉丝点击